Troubleshooting XP random freeze ups
run: antivirus,Spybot,Ad-aware, Spyware Blaster, CWShredder
-various on-line anti-virus/anti-trojan scans
-chkdsk /r from DOS
-hard drive diagnostics
-memory diagnostics
-resolve any IRQ conflicts
-update all drivers
-resolve any Event Viewer errors
-reseat RAM
-reseat all PCI cards, IDE cables, drives
-decelerate hard drive----(Display>Settings>Advanced>Troubleshoot>slider at half
-disable IE pop up blocker
-set MSCONFIG to normal startup (previously selective startup)
-BIOS changed from pnp OS to no pnp OS, then back again
-temperature OK, fans working
-BIOS update if available
-disable hibernation and disk/monitor shutoffs
-disable screensaver
-disable Windows Firewall, and all exceptions
-security set to medium
-verify router settings
-underclock processor, example: 133 mhz to 100

The above check list resolved my xp pro random freeze ups. Hope it helps you.
